Is it possible to prevent analytics collection from dev environment?

  • 7 December 2022
  • 3 replies
  • 54 views

Hi Heap team, I’m about to start set up heap for the work project. Is there any way to setup heap to collect analytics only from production environments and not collect it from development ones?

Hi @Tatiana - Welcome to the Heap Community! 

The simplest was to not collect analytics in your dev environment is to not include the Heap snippet in dev environment pages. 

I see you’re a software engineer - are you also looking for a way to capture server-side events in your product environment, but not dev?
